Yeah, the lady at the hydro store first suggested this to me a few months ago. I thought she was just trying to sell me the potting soil to go with the OF. After a few failed clone attempts, I did buy the potting soil and I had way better success. Once the clones got bigger, they went in OF. IDK? Works for me. The soil seemed to be the only constant in my failure with cloning so, I tried another way and it worked. I also use perlite as well.

Personally,I clone directly into pure perlite for 21/2 weeks and then transplant into a FF-OF with a 60% perlite mix.I cant remember losing a clone in this manner.P.S.I use 30 watt floros for the light source during the 21/2 weeks.
